2 Eject (

0) button

This button is used to eject the disc.

3 BUSY indicator

Flashes during data access.

4 Volume Control (headphone level)

This is used to adjust the volume level of the headphone jack.

5 Headphone jack (PHONES)

This is a stereo minijack for headphones.

1 Disc loading slot

Insert the DVD-ROM or CD-ROM with the label facing up.
When using 8 cm (3.15-inch) discs, attach a CD adapter (available at stores) to the
disc, and insert the disc into the disc loading slot. (Refer to page 12.)
